  • Classic Match Manchester United vs Ipswich Town at Old Trafford (Manchester), in Premier League 1994/1995 Manchester United success to beat Ipswich Town 9 - 0
    goals
    1 : 0 Roy Keane 15' (Manchester United)
    2 : 0 Andy Cole 19' (Manchester United)
    3 : 0 Andy Cole 37' (Manchester United)
    4 : 0 Andy Cole 52' (Manchester United)
    5 : 0 Mark Hughes 53' (Manchester United)
    6 : 0 Mark Hughes 59' (Manchester United)
    7 : 0 Andy Cole 65' (Manchester United)
    8 : 0 Paul Ince 68' (Manchester United)
    9 : 0 Andy Cole 87' (Manchester United)
